专栏名称: 鸿洋
你好,欢迎关注鸿洋的公众号,每天为您推送高质量文章,让你每天都能涨知识。点击历史消息,查看所有已推送的文章,喜欢可以置顶本公众号。此外,本公众号支持投稿,如果你有原创的文章,希望通过本公众号发布,欢迎投稿。
目录
相关文章推荐
开发者全社区  ·  陆家嘴某基金老登被曝光 ·  昨天  
开发者全社区  ·  小仙女逼婚失败...称遇假A8.5 ·  昨天  
开发者全社区  ·  辅导员投稿:和我的学生越界了 ·  昨天  
开发者全社区  ·  裁员杀红了眼? ·  2 天前  
开发者全社区  ·  跟师兄表白被拒绝了 ·  3 天前  
51好读  ›  专栏  ›  鸿洋

HarmonyOS NEXT实战:元服务与应用 APP 发布应用市场的详细步骤与流程

鸿洋  · 公众号  · android  · 2025-02-11 08:35

正文

本文作者: JasonYin ,原文发布于: 印丽宇吧

发布上架需要以下几个步骤:

  • 申请发布证书(需要 签名、CSR、.P12文件)、申请发布Profile、打包APP、发布元服务。

  • 证书、.P12文件同一个项目可以公用,Profile只能 一对一。
1
申请发布证书

证书是为HarmonyOS应用/元服务配置签名信息的数字证书,可保障软件代码完整性和发布者身份真实性。证书格式为 .cer ,包含公钥、证书指纹等信息。

  • 注意:

    1、每个账号最多可申请3个发布证书。

    2、若Profile状态变为“失效”或“已吊销”,表示当前Profile已不可用,您需要重新申请Profile。

  • 点击 证书、APP ID和Profile

  • 新增证书,选择 发布证书

  • 选取证书请求文件(CSR):
    1、创建CSR文件

    1.2、创建.p12文件


    1.3 Next下一步,生成CSR 文件

  • 选取CSR文件,并提交生成证书;证书下载到某个地方,后面用。



2
申请发布Profile

Profile格式为.p7b,包含HarmonyOS应用/元服务的包名、数字证书信息、HarmonyOS应用/元服务允许申请的证书权限列表,以及允许应用/元服务调试的设备列表(如果应用/元服务类型为Release类型,则设备列表为空)等内容。每个HarmonyOS应用/元服务包中均必须包含一个Profile文件。

  • 注意: 一个应用最多可申请100个Profile文件。

  • 添加

  • 生成 Profile



3
打包APP


  • 项目级 build-profile.json5 里的"signingConfigs": []目前啥也没有。

  • File --> Project Structure 1.选Signing Configs 2.取消自动签名 3.选刚才生成的 .p12文件 4.输入刚才填的密码 5.输入对应的别名 6.和上面的密码一样 7.选刚才生成的 Profile 文件 8.选刚才生成的 .cer 文件,也就是证书。

  • signingConfigs

  • 打包APP。Build-->Build Hap/APP-->Build APP

  • BUILD SUCCESSFUL 之后,就代表打包成功了。

  • 打包后的包在这里找,这个就是后面要上架到应用市场的包了。



4
发布元服务以及应用

  • 我的应用

  • 应用信息页面
    1.带*号的必填,填符合对应的信息。

    2、元服务应用图标,点击 + ,进入到当前项目文件目录,选startIcon, 修改startIcon图标;点击下一步,进入到 准备提交 页面。

    3、应用图标和元服务 的不太一样。







请到「今天看啥」查看全文


推荐文章
开发者全社区  ·  陆家嘴某基金老登被曝光
昨天
开发者全社区  ·  小仙女逼婚失败...称遇假A8.5
昨天
开发者全社区  ·  辅导员投稿:和我的学生越界了
昨天
开发者全社区  ·  裁员杀红了眼?
2 天前
开发者全社区  ·  跟师兄表白被拒绝了
3 天前
网易梦幻西游手游  ·  这身行头一看就是精英!求抱大腿~~~
7 年前